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
807413 045 868 107
135 917 713993
135 917 713993
89208 50 881959 296
All about undefined
Interested in learning more?
135 917 713993
89208 50 881959 296
See more
63960477 82312248005 159612
811 187854 35147120017
See more
13242265554 78935706 690638
61777990 60 49724 46775 22274292551
See more